Overall, the Glycoprotein Market is poised for steady growth in the coming years, presenting lucrative opportunities for market players and investors.</p></p> <p><strong>Get a Sample PDF of the Report:</strong> <a href="https://www.reportprime.com/enquiry/request-sample/15452">https://www.reportprime.com/enquiry/request-sample/15452</a></p> <p>&nbsp;</p> <p><strong>Market Segmentation</strong></p> <p><strong>The Glycoprotein Market Analysis by types is segmented into:</strong></p> <p><ul><li>N-linkage</li><li>O-linkage</li><li>Others</li></ul></p> <p>&nbsp;</p> <p><p>The Glycoprotein market can be categorized into different types based on the linkage of carbohydrates to the protein. N-linkage involves attachment of carbohydrates to the nitrogen atom of the amino acid asparagine, while O-linkage involves attachment to the oxygen atom of the amino acid serine or threonine. Other types of linkages may also exist, including C-linkage or S-linkage. Understanding these different linkage types is important in the development and production of glycoprotein-based products in various industries.</p></p> <p><strong>Get a Sample PDF of the Report:</strong>&nbsp;<a href="https://www.reportprime.com/enquiry/request-sample/15452">https://www.reportprime.com/enquiry/request-sample/15452</a></p> <p>&nbsp;</p> <p><strong>The Glycoprotein Market Industry Research by Application is segmented into:</strong></p> <p><ul><li>Hospital</li><li>Research Institutes</li><li>Others</li></ul></p> <p>&nbsp;</p> <p><p>The glycoprotein market finds applications in various sectors such as hospitals, research institutes, and others.
